5 days is good, it took longer for me Smiley The point is that they are not scammers, they won't steal your money, but they are just very slow and this can be an issue.

Loading the cards via cryptocurrency is automated and it works perfect, the card limits are decent, so that's what i was looking for. Cards even support Mastercard Secure Code / 3d secure and contactless payments.

Did not try any of the other services like wires and stuff and i won't, because they might be processed manually and it will probably be very slow.

I guess since almost all other card programs are dead, people are moving over to them ... This is not an excuse though, they should hire more people.

I have ePayments card (4.95€) aswell and it works like a charm! The load cia crypto is just perfect and almost no fees at all! (Its my main card right now)
Only cons i´ve see is that they dont let you have an e-wallet in crypto!

I also have an uPayCard (0.00€), it works very good aswell, some minor problems at start but the prompt live chat solved the issues every time! This solution have a litle more fees to load the card but still a very viable choice! The only cryptos working with upaycard is Ethereum and Bitcoin! But you can have an e-wallet in ETH or BTC and decide when to load to the card!

This are the only cards i know that is working right now!

If you manage big amounts of money you can use Mistertango (0.00€) aswell but the fees for loading is a bit higher than the 2 above.... and only accept BTC as crypto to load the card!

Card providers:

UpayCard : PSI-PAY LTD
ePayments : PSI-PAY LTD
Mistertango : WireCard

So this providers will last! i think! Cheesy

The ePayments and uPayCard arrived in my country (Portugal) in 1 week, the Mistertango it takes 2-3weeks! But you have options to pay extra, for fast-delivery!
